How much does it cost to rent an apartment in South Sarasota?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
South Sarasota Studio Apartments | $1,994 | $1,250 | $3,197 |
South Sarasota 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,141 | $990 | $10,000+ |
South Sarasota 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,596 | $1,250 | $7,975 |
South Sarasota 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,249 | $1,295 | $10,000+ |
South Sarasota 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,237 | $1,050 | $9,928 |
